Transaction afbf73d0bf76ab687be641c3cbdef6922efdc7a33e894b98a24bfc8eb5103823
1 Input
2 Outputs
- afbf73d0bf76ab687be641c3cbdef6922efdc7a33e894b98a24bfc8eb5103823:0
- afbf73d0bf76ab687be641c3cbdef6922efdc7a33e894b98a24bfc8eb5103823:1
value 1052080
address 3ABvsHh4BA4rcGeLZcuhcFhHA8DNYJUHxi
value 24051404
address 3MZHnreX7ku5PxxYHq2MmKSUfUdGnx3RMR